1976 Mazda RX-4 vs. 2008 Renault Laguna

To start off, 2008 Renault Laguna is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Mazda RX-4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Mazda RX-4 would be higher. At 2,616 cc, 1976 Mazda RX-4 is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Renault Laguna weights approximately 245 kg more than 1976 Mazda RX-4.

Because 1976 Mazda RX-4 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 Mazda RX-4.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Renault Laguna,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Renault Laguna (170 Nm @ 3750 RPM) has 5 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Mazda RX-4. (165 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2008 Renault Laguna will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Mazda RX-4.
